apate <539>

apath apate

Pronunciation:ap-at'-ay
Origin:from 538
Reference:TDNT - 1:385,65
PrtSpch:n f
In Greek:apataiv 1, apath 4, apathv 2
In NET:seductiveness 2, deception 2, deceitful 1, deceitful pleasures 1
In AV:deceitfulness 3, deceitful 1, deceit 1, deceivableness 1, deceivings 1
Count:7
Definition:1) deceit, deceitfulness
from 538; delusion:-deceit(-ful, -fulness), deceivableness(-ving).
